Why These Are the Top Honda Repair Auto Repair Shops in Parma

** The Honda repair market for residents of Parma, Idaho, is almost entirely reliant on the Boise metropolitan area. Parma itself lacks specialized automotive service providers. The market in Boise is competitive and of high quality, featuring multiple dealerships and several reputable independent shops that cater to Japanese imports, specifically Honda. Pricing follows a typical tiered structure: dealerships (like Honda of Boise) command the highest labor rates but offer the most direct manufacturer support, while independent specialists (like Gem State Honda & Acura Repair) provide significant cost savings with comparable expertise for non-warranty work. For very specific and complex issues—especially involving hybrid systems, SH-AWD, or the latest computer diagnostics—the dealership is often the most equipped option. For performance tuning, engine rebuilds, and transmission work, the well-regarded independents are highly competitive and often preferred by enthusiasts.

What are the most common Honda repair issues seen in Parma, Idaho, due to local driving conditions?

In Parma, common issues include premature brake wear from frequent stops on rural roads and dusty conditions affecting air filters and cabin air quality. Additionally, the temperature fluctuations can stress batteries and cooling systems in Hondas, making regular checks important.

How can I find a reputable and trustworthy Honda repair shop in the Parma area?

Look for shops with ASE-certified technicians, specifically those with Honda or Japanese import experience. Check reviews from local customers in Canyon County and ask if they use genuine Honda parts or high-quality alternatives, as this is a key indicator of service quality.

When should I seek service for my Honda's CVT transmission, which is common in many models?

Seek service immediately if you notice hesitation, jerking, or unusual whining noises, especially before longer drives on Idaho highways like I-84. Regular CVT fluid changes are critical and should be performed per your Honda's maintenance schedule to prevent costly failures.

What local considerations should I keep in mind for seasonal Honda maintenance in Parma?

Before winter, have your battery, tire tread, and heating system checked for drives on potentially icy roads in Canyon County. In spring, inspect the undercarriage for corrosion from road treatments and clean the air conditioning system to handle summer heat during trips to the Treasure Valley.
